The PR & Communications team is expanding, and we have a brand-new role for someone to really put their stamp on.

We're looking for a part-time
Community Engagement Specialist, who will be responsible for all aspects of our 'Giving for Good' charity fund, including coming up with ways we can donate the funds, and work with different charities across the UK on initiatives and projects to raise awareness and funding.

Your day to day will include researching, creating, implementing, communicating and reporting social value-add and philanthropic activities.

You will be an active member of the Charity Committee, collaborating with external partners, including the groups chosen charities and internal teams, such as human resources, finance and data teams to identify and quantify social value-add.


A little more of what you'll do:

  • Implement the group charity strategy, ensuring alignment with the group's overall strategy
  • Write and publish press releases and PR opportunities on our work with charities
  • Support onboarding of new initiatives, communicating changes internally and externally.
  • Draft and publish relevant internal and external communications
  • Coordinate employee engagement activities and events and implement initiatives
  • Support the operating companies in England, Scotland and Wales in centrally coordinated and bespoke volunteering and philanthropic activities
  • Engage in educational & community activities to deliver positive social value and create and deliver training opportunities internally
  • Identify appropriate frameworks for best practice reporting and monitor, track and report social value performance progress
  • Identify suitable awards and opportunities to promote project activities

What we need from you:


You'll have excellent communication skills and the ability to influence and promote a positive culture on how social sustainability practically impacts the business and communities.


We're looking for previous experience in writing press releases, internal communications and briefings, and a proven track record of delivering broad social value-add and community engagement action.


You'll have the ability to undertake project planning, project management and work to budgets, be proficient on Microsoft suite and have programme management experience with a structured approach to organising and documenting progress through KPI monitoring and performance reporting.
